Eighteen visions

Eighteen Visions is an American metalcore band from Orange County, California. Formed in October 1995, the band split in April 2007, less than a year after the release of its first major album, at Epic Records and Trustkill Records. After a decade of absence, they return in 2017. They announce their sixth album, XVIII, at Rise Records.

On April 20, 2017, ten years after their farewell tour, the group confirms a new album, XVIII, for June 2, 2017 at the label Rise Records; the clip of the single Oath is published in parallel. On May 9, 2017, Crucified, the second single from the album, is released as a YouTube video. Both songs last only two minutes and mark a return to powerful screaming, an element of their early career. The band also confirms that the song Live Again is dedicated to MickDeth (Mick Morris)>. XVIII is announced on June 2, 2017. This is their first album since Vanity (2002) to include lyrics of movies in their songs. A clip of the song Live Again is also released that same day.
